Performing Arts Center to Light Holiday Tree

The AT&T Performing Arts Center will hold the third annual Holiday at the Center Tree Lighting Festival on Nov. 30.

Lights, music and the holiday spirit will help kick off a month long list of festivities.

Activities and attractions include an ice-skating rink, a life-size snow globe, and free pictures with Santa. 

Entertainment will be provided by the Dallas String Quartet, Jaime Reyes Trio, and other local performance groups.

The holiday tree lighting ceremony will begin at 6:40 p.m. and will include a performance from Cirque Dreams Holidaze.

The Festival is free and open to all ages. Parking is available for a fee and all entrances are on Jack Evans Drive.

The AT&T Performing Arts Center is located at 2403 Flora Street in the Dallas Arts District.
